Understanding the Basics of Plinko

At its core, plinko is a game of chance where a ball is dropped from the top of a board filled with pegs. As the ball descends, it ricochets off these pegs, changing direction with each impact. The ultimate goal is to land the ball into one of several slots at the bottom of the board, each assigned a different payout multiplier. The higher the multiplier, the more valuable the slot, but also, generally, the harder it is to land in. The beauty of plinko resides in its seemingly random nature, offering excitement with every drop.

The initial stages of playing plinko usually involve selecting a stake amount. This determines the potential payout, as winnings are directly proportional to the initial bet and the landing slot’s multiplier. Moreover, many iterations of the game allow players to choose a risk level, influencing the distribution of multipliers across the slots. High-risk options feature larger potential winnings but lower probabilities, while lower-risk selections provide smaller, more frequent payouts. The Role of Probability in Plinko

While plinko appears random, probability significantly influences the outcome. Although each bounce is technically unpredictable, the overall distribution of multipliers tends to follow a pattern. Slots located in the center of the board generally have a higher probability of being hit, as the ball is more likely to gravitate towards the middle due to the symmetrical arrangement of the pegs. However, these central slots often have lower multipliers than those on the edges, presenting a classic risk-reward scenario.

Understanding this probabilistic element can help players make informed decisions. It’s essential to recognize that, in the long run, the house always has an edge. Plinko, like all casino games, is designed to generate a profit for the operator, and this is achieved through the inherent advantage built into the game’s structure. However, a savvy player can mitigate risk by carefully managing their stake size and selecting the appropriate risk level for their preferred playing style. Focusing on strategic play doesn’t guarantee a win, but it increases the likelihood of enjoying a longer and potentially more rewarding session.

The concept of expected value is crucial when evaluating plinko strategies. Expected value is a calculation that considers both the probability of winning and the size of the potential payout. A positive expected value suggests that a game has the potential to be profitable over the long term, while a negative expected value indicates that the odds are stacked against the player. While consistently achieving a positive expected value in plinko is challenging, understanding the principle can guide players towards smarter decision-making.

The Psychological Aspects of Plinko

The appeal of plinko isn’t solely based on the potential for monetary gain; psychological factors also play a significant role. The visually captivating nature of the game and the suspenseful descent of the ball trigger a sense of excitement and anticipation. The random nature of the outcome taps into our inherent fascination with chance and the thrill of the unknown. This combined creates engaging gameplay.

The concept of near misses—when the ball lands close to a lucrative slot but ultimately falls into a less rewarding one—can be particularly compelling. Near misses activate the same brain regions as winning, creating a sense of hope and encouraging players to continue playing. This psychological phenomenon can lead to a cycle of continued wagering, even in the face of losses.
